Body Line Sports win the MDFA Women’s League

Body Line Sports brought out the Champion in them on the final day of the Mumbai District Football Association (MDFA) Women’s League as they thrashed Smart Football Leader 5-0 to edge out S.P. Academy on goal difference to claim the MDFA Women’s League crown.
It was a thrilling end to the league as Body Line Sports were at their ruthless best as they thrashed Smart Football Leader 5-0. Body Line needed a win by at least three goals to go ahead of S.P. Academy on goal difference.
Kimberly Fernandez set Body Line on their way with an opening goal which was followed by Zarastyn Mistry netting her first of the two goals in the evening.
Ameeta Venkat scored the all-important third goal which put Body Line on level terms with S.P. Academy in terms of goal difference. But Body Line romped home the momentum and added two more goals from Kimberly Miranda and Zarastyn Mistry.
The win meant Body Line Sports moved into the driving seat in the MDFA Women’s league with a three point over S.P. Academy before latter clashed with Companeroes in the final game.
S.P. Academy needed to beat Companeroes by three goals in order to snatch back the initiative from Body Line and seemed to be on their way to do so when Abeer Arsiwala fired them into a first half lead. But a resilient Companeroes side who enjoyed Body Line’s support defended heroically to deny S.P. Academy any further goals handing Body Line the title on virtue on superior goal difference.
Body Line and S.P. Academy both finished on 17 points each with Body Line edging past their rivals with a goal difference of +15 compared to S.P. Academy’s +14
The MDFA President handed the winners and the runners-up trophy to the respective teams. Sanjeevani Academy finished the season in third place on 14 points.
S.P. Academy’s Abeer Arsiwala who was the stand out player throughout the league was righly awarded the player of the tournament. Abeer has represented the national team at the U-19 level and is a great ambassador for the league.
